// Specified Skilled Worker Visa

Overview, Eligibility & Process

Overview & Types

SSW (i)

Up to 5 years total stay, requires Japanese language (JLPT N4 or JFT-Basic), skill exams, and does not allow family accompaniment.

SSW (ii)

Renewable with no stay limit, no Japanese exam required, and allows bringing family under conditions.

Eligible Industries

Includes Nursing Care, Building Cleaning, Industrial Manufacturing, Construction, Automobile Maintenance, Aviation, Accommodation, Food/Beverage Manufacturing, Food Service, Agriculture, Fisheries, Forestry, Shipbuilding, and more—totaling 14 to 16 categories.

Requirements & Application

  • Age: Typically over 18
  • Must pass Japanese exam (JLPT N4 or JFT-Basic) and industry-specific skill test, unless completed Technical Intern Training Program (TITP)
  • Process: Secure job → Company applies for Certificate of Eligibility → Apply for visa at embassy → Arrive and start working

Statistics (Dec 2023)

  • SSW (i): ~208,462 holders
  • SSW (ii): only 37 holders
  • Largest industries: Food & Beverage Manufacturing (61k), Machinery/Electronics (40k), Nursing Care (28k), Construction (24k), Agriculture (23k)
